Product Overview
Protect your transducers with Pettit's premium made antifoulng transducer paint.
Formulated to protect electronics transducers from underwater fouling in both fresh and salt water. For use on plastic transducer housings and bare metals such as steel, stainless steel, cast iron, copper, bronze, galvanized steel and lead. It forms an excellent adhesive bond to underwater metals and running gear and inhibits corrosion. Because of its smooth hard surface air will self-clean in service, and can be used above or below the waterline. Do not overcoat with antifouling paint. Spray can for easy application. 6oz. Dark gray.

Application
- Application Method: Aerosol Spray
- Number of Coats Recommended: 2 or 3 (Do not apply more than three coats as cracking and loss of adhesion may occur)
- Dry Film Thickness/coat: 1.5 Mils.
- Application Temperature Min./Max. Range: 50° F. Min.90° F. Max.
- Thinner: 120 Brushing Thinner
Drying Times* (Hours)
Drying | @50°F | @70°F | @90°F |
---|---|---|---|
To recoat | 2 hr. | 1 hr. | 1/2 hr. |
To launch | 48 hr. | 24 hr. | 16 hr. |
